You need to put a slash at the end of each line.

( b2 f4- ) r | r2 r4 r8d d15 | ( d2 b4 ) r4 | r4 ( c45 e g4- ) | r4 ( a44 g4+ f 
) /

b45 r4 r2 | ( d25 b4 c | f44dd a3 g f4 ) r4 /
